I’m very secure in who I am, the work I do – Priyanka Chopra

Priyanka Chopra, who is currently busy shooting the second season of TV series Quantico says gone are the days when actors used to feel insecure with each other’s success.

When asked if actors today have become more open when it comes to appreciating the work of their colleagues, she said that is such an age-old stereotype and definitely not in her DNA.

“I’m very secure in who I am and the work I do. These are my friends and colleagues, and I like to share in their achievements and happiness. Good work should be applauded. I believe that there is enough work out there for everyone. We don’t live in the dark ages any more.”

The year 2016 also saw her becoming the presenter at Oscar Awards and Emmy Awards, followed by an invitation to the annual White House Correspondents Dinner.
